About US Neuro  

US Neuro is a nationwide provider of intraoperative neurophysiologic monitoring (IONM) and EEG services. We work closely with leading hospitals and surgical teams to enhance patient safety during complex procedures. Our commitment to clinical quality, responsiveness, and collaboration has made us a trusted partner in neuromonitoring since 2005.

Key Responsibilities  

(Responsibilities vary based on experience level)  

Experienced Surgical Neurophysiologist  

  • Independently perform IONM during spinal, neuro, ENT, and other surgeries 
  • Operate, calibrate, and troubleshoot equipment in real time during procedures 
  • Identify and communicate significant waveform changes to surgical teams and oversight neurologists 
  • Document and maintain high-quality intraoperative records 
  • Mentor junior staff and contribute to clinical education as needed 
  • Participate in continuing education and advanced case types (e.g., craniotomies, phase reversal, DCS) 

Trainee Surgical Neurophysiologist  

  • Assist with patient preparation, electrode application, and monitoring setup in the operating room 
  • Observe and support neurophysiological data collection during surgical procedures 
  • Participate in structured, supervised training to become CNIM-eligible 
  • Maintain accurate documentation and follow hospital safety and infection control protocols 
  • Travel between affiliated hospitals and surgical centers as needed
